The postcode WF17 6AE is located in Kirklees, in the county of West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. WF17 6AE is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

WF17 6AE is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of WF17 6AE as Multicultural metropolitans > Challenged Asian terraces > Pakistani communities.

The closest road name to WF17 6AE is Skipton Street which is centered 18 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Hyrstlands Road Howard St and is 157 m away. The closest railway station is Batley Rail Station, 1 km away.

The closest primary school to WF17 6AE (for ages 11 and under) is Warwick Road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 12,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St John Fisher Catholic Voluntary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on May 9, 2019 rated this school as Special Measures

The nearest takeaway food is available from The Three Chefs and is 111 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on September 30,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 72.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 10.4 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for WF17 6AE is covered by the West Yorkshire police force association and Kirklees is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
